DSEI 2025 marked some significant milestones for us at ACUA, and we are still buzzing with follow ups and the potential for new demonstration opportunities.
Just 2 years ago we attended DSEI 2023 as delegates, discovering more about how the defence and security sector could benefit from payload-oriented uncrewed surface vessels (USVs) and refining our niche within the market.
This year we returned with our Pioneer USV and remote operations centre, having brought the ideas and requirements of the sector through our designs into the real thing, showcasing our capability and solidifying our place as a supplier. A full circle of feedback.

Anyway, some highlights from the 2025 event for us:
⚓️ Pioneer’s first trip to London. Despite the threat of a storm getting in the way, our operations team navigated the coastal trip from Plymouth to the Excel in London seamlessly. She arrived at the event piloted by Simon Chapman and quickly became our base for meeting customers when the sun was shining!

⚓️ UK and international delegations. In just 3 days we hosted over 60 pre-booked meetings at our stand and tours of Pioneer, including 6 international navy delegations. During these, we showed the multitude of payload opportunities Pioneer is capable of, and real world data in our dockside operations centre.
⚓️ News and announcements during the week:
📣 The announcement of our recent 24-hour operation powered by hydrogen reached the BBC: https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/articles/ckgzm0xr909o
📣 Serco and ACUA Ocean announced a strategic partnership for uncrewed maritime solutions.
📣 ACUA Ocean and @Systems, Engineering and Assessment Ltd signed an MoU to explore the deployment of integrated ASW and ISR capabilities using USVs
📣 A Serco-led consortium, including ACUA, was announced to develop autonomous ASW for the @Royal Navy.
